Description

Shipping details, return details, q: will a standard changing pad cover fit the changer pad that's included.

A:  We cannot recommend using a third-party or non-4moms brand sheet or accessory with the 4moms® Breeze® Plus playard.

Q: Is a sheet included with the Playard?

A:  A sheet is not included with the 4moms® Breeze® Plus Playard.

Q: is this playard greenguard and/or greenguard gold certified?

A:  No, the Breeze Plus Playard is not Greenguard Certified. All our products meet or exceed the regulations and laws established and enforced by the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) and their regulatory counterparts around the world. 4moms® also uses an independent, internationally accredited testing lab to test our products regularly, throughout their life cycle.

Q: What are the dimensions, length, width, height

A:  The dimensions for the Breeze® Plus Playard are 30" W x 43" L x 29" H.

Q: Is the bassitnet suitable and safe for all night sleeping?

A:  The 4moms Breeze® Playard meets all relevant playpen safety standards.  The Breeze® Playard is intended for playing or sleeping.  When used for playing, never leave child unattended and always keep child in view.  When used for sleeping, you must still provide the supervision necessary for the continued safety of your child. We recommend you follow the Consumer Product Safety Commission’s (CPSC) safe sleeping guidelines. If you’d like to view a copy, please visit: https://www.cpsc.gov/safety-education/safety-guides/cribs/keep-your-baby-safe

Q: Hi, Re: Specs...What is the upper weight limit for the bassinet and also the changer? Thanks,

A:  The breeze plus playard bassinet can be used until the baby begins to push up on their hands and knees or roll over, or when they reach 18 pounds - whichever comes first. The changing table can be used until the baby reaches 25 pounds.

Q: Can I put a regular crib mattress into the play yard?

A:  We do not manufacture additional padding or mattresses for the breeze, and we do not recommend adding mattresses, padding, pillows, stuffed animals, or similar materials to the breeze playard. This is in alignment with safe sleep recommendations, as the breeze playard is an approved overnight sleep surface. -Hillary

Q: What model number is this?

A:  The model number for this version of the breeze plus playard is 1045.

Q: How high is it from the mattress to the top of the playard?

A:  The breeze plus playard measures 22" from the playard mattress, when in the playard portion, to the top railing.

Q: What are the dimensions of the mattresses? Play yard, bassinet and changing pad?

A:  The playard mattress for the breeze plus playard measures 41" x 28.5" x .5". The bassinet mattress measures 29" x 23" x 0.5". The changer mattress, where the baby lays, measures 9” x 21.75” x 4”.

While cribs and bassinets are the preferred regular sleeping spots for little ones, it’s not exactly practical to rent them or bring them along while traveling. That’s where pack and plays, or playards, come in handy: These portable and safe sleep solutions are great for trips, snoozing at the grandparents’ house, and other on-the-go napping needs.

We rigorously tested 13 pack and plays in our Verywell Testing Lab in New York City, with a clear winner emerging as our overall favorite: the 4moms Breeze Plus Portable Playard. 

Following the lab test, one of our testers took the 4moms Breeze Plus out for real-world testing. Over the course of six months, she used it at her in-laws’ house for her daughter to sleep in when visiting the grandparents. Keep reading for all of the details on how this playard performed in the lab and during thorough long-term testing.

This pack and play is for families who want a convenient, easy-to-use, and safe place for their little one to sleep in —and get their diaper changed in— while away from home . Ideal for travelers, it’s also convenient for stowing at a relative’s house for frequent visits.

Design and Features

According to our lab testers, the 4moms Breeze Plus’ sophisticated, intentional design makes it stand out from the pack. Each feature enhances the user experience without overloading the playard with unnecessary elements. With a changer attachment, the pack and play doubles as a changing table, so you can comfortably change your baby’s diapers and clothing without needing to kneel on the floor or rent an additional piece of gear. The changing station “flips over to the side [of the pack and play], which is very convenient,” a lab tester noted, adding that it saves both time and space. In addition to the changer, which can be used for little ones up to 25 pounds, the 4mom Breeze Plus comes with a bassinet attachment for newborns up to 18 pounds. 

Other small but thoughtful features include the two extra legs in the center of the pack and play, which provide additional stability for squirmy sleepers. Testers also appreciated that pieces of the adjustable mattress can be unzipped and rearranged to make a mattress for the bassinet attachment, allowing for multiple configurations without taking up additional storage space. 

“The mattress is nice and soft, and it wraps around the pack and play, so you can slip it into the storage bag,” a lab tester said.

Compactness and Folding

In our lab test, the 4moms Breeze Plus was one of the easiest large playards to assemble, collapse, and fold up for travel or storage. Simply press down on the 4moms logo in the middle of the playard to expand it, then, to collapse, pull up on the attached strap in the same spot. And you can do both of these one-handed!

At ‎43 x 30 x 29 inches, it’s a larger pack and play, so it still takes up a good amount of space when folded. That tradeoff is probably worth the ample space it provides for growing kids. Plus, our real-world tester had no problem fitting the playard into a closet and the car trunk.

Setting up this playard is a little time-consuming but quite straightforward. It took our testers about 10 minutes to fully assemble this care station, due to the additional attachments that needed to be placed just right to be secure and safe. However, despite the assembly time, it was simple and intuitive to put together.

Portability and Maneuverability 

Despite its weight (28.5 pounds with the attachments), the 4moms Breeze Plus Portable Playard was, indeed, portable. As part of the lab test, testers pulled the pack and play across a linoleum floor and shag rug to assess how easy it would be to move. Thanks to the stacked wheels, it maneuvered smoothly across both surfaces without getting stuck, and it was easy to carry across our testing space, suggesting that moving it between rooms and taking it out of storage would be no problem.

Included with the care station is a zippered travel bag, which has a carrying strap for transporting it into the hotel, car, grandparents’ house, or whatever your destination may be.

Kids can get messy, so we appreciated how easy the playard was to clean. Though none of its parts are machine washable, spot cleaning was effective. In the lab, we asked testers to intentionally spill applesauce on it to see how easily it could be wiped off. Testers were impressed that the mess wiped right off, especially given the material’s dark black color.

First, we tested the 4moms Breeze Plus in our lab in New York City alongside 12 other models, evaluating it on characteristics like ease of assembly, size/compactness, design and special features, portability/maneuverability, and durability. Our lab testers put the Breeze Plus together and took it back down, examined its features, dragged it across several types of flooring, fit it into its included travel bag, and purposely spilled applesauce on it. The Breeze Plus was declared the winner at the end of the test.

Next, a real-world tester used the 4moms pack and play at home and on the go with her own child over the course of six months. “It’s extremely intuitive [to use], incredibly easy to set up, and our baby really sleeps ‘like a baby’ in it,” she said. Her family primarily uses the playard at a relative’s house. It fit well in their trunk when transporting it, and they store it in the closet when not in use.

Price: Worth It for Families on the Go

Retailing for $300, the 4moms Breeze Plus Portable Playard is an investment, but it’s a worthwhile one for families that travel frequently . For families who are on a tight budget or do not travel frequently, there may be better-suited options out there, but this is the gold standard of a durable, high-quality playard. Per a tester, it’s “well worth the cost and has everything parents need in a pack and play.”

Plus, with the bassinet attachment, diaper changer, and travel bag included, the Breeze Plus is a better deal than it might sound like at first. These accessories could cost up to a few hundred dollars if purchased separately, and may not be compatible with standard playards, anyway. 

Different families may be looking for different things from their playards. Factoring in various budgets, traveling habits, and available space, we also tested a number of other pack and plays with similar yet distinct features from the Breeze Plus. 

Graco Pack ‘n Play Portable Playard : For those looking for a budget-friendly option, the Graco Pack ‘n Play is a no-frills choice that provides a safe space for your baby to sleep without breaking the bank. At $70, it’s over $200 less than the 4moms playard, making it great for infrequent travelers, too.

Guava Family Lotus Travel Crib : Weighing just 11 pounds, the Guava Family Lotus was our pick for Best Compact in our travel crib test, making it ideal for when space is at a premium. However, our real-world tester reported that she prefers the 4moms Breeze Plus to her Guava Family Lotus despite its larger footprint, noting that the 4moms model has “by far an easier setup” and is only $20 more.

Bugaboo Stardust Playard : If saving space is a priority, the Bugaboo Stardust is a compact, lightweight pack and play. At $339, it is a bit pricier than the 4moms Breeze Plus, but if space is at a premium, testers found it worth it for the smaller footprint. (They were even able to slide it under a couch for out-of-the-way storage.) The Stardust’s easy collapsing process and sophisticated look are also pluses.

This pack and play’s most standout feature was its thoughtful design, including its stacked wheels, the bassinet attachment, and the diaper-changing station. The playard is comfortable for the little one to sleep in and easy for caregivers to use, despite its larger size. Other exceptional qualities include how the rearrangeable mattress and how easy it is to set up and collapse with one hand.

  • Product Name Breeze Plus Portable Playard
  • Product Brand 4moms
  • Price $300.00
  • Weight 28.5 lbs.
  • Product Dimensions 40 x 30 x 29 in.
  • Warranty 1-year warranty
  • What’s Included Bassinet attachment, diaper-changing attachment, travel bag with strap
  • Weight Capacity 30 lbs. for the playard; 25 lbs. for the changer; 18 lbs. for the bassinet

4moms was launched in 2005 by Henry Thorne and Rob Daley, a roboticist, and businessman looking for a new business venture. After researching various industries, the friends settled on the juvenile product industry as a good opportunity. Established under the parent company Thorley Industries the 4moms moniker comes from the first focus group for the company that helped provide insight that led to the development of the first product, an infant tub. Today, 4moms is a quickly growing company offering a variety of baby gear with a unique edge.

Performance Comparison

4moms breeze travel crib review - the 4moms is very easy to set up and the included bassinet only adds...

Ease of Use

The Breeze is one of the easiest options to set up and takedown in the review. It took us just over 8 minutes to set up the Breeze and just over 9 minutes with the bassinet. After multiple tests, we whittled that down to an average time of 2:22 minutes.

4moms is easy to set up with a center button you push to lock the...

This crib is easy to set up with one button (above left) and snapping the bassinet in place over the top rails if you plan to use it (above right).

4moms breeze travel crib review - the hardest part of setting up the 4moms is attaching the mattress...

Affixing the mattress to the bottom is the hardest part as the Velcro tabs want to attach to the wrong place when you slide them through the bottom.

4moms breeze travel crib review - the 4moms is the largest folded package made harder to manage with...

Portability

The Breeze is not the most portable option you can purchase. This travel crib is the second heaviest one in the group with a folded carrying case weight of 22 lbs and 12 oz, if you add the bassinet, the weight becomes 23.9 lbs. This weight is heavier than many parents want to carry for very long and could make traveling with the Breeze difficult. It is the largest folded option measuring 12.1"H x 30.7"L x 12.2"W in the travel bag. Fitting the crib in the carry bag is hard, and there are no directions. The bassinet doesn't fit at all, so you'll end up with two things to carry instead of one which decreases transportability. The carry bag handles are long so you could sling it over your shoulder, but the weight will prohibit most parents from doing so.

4moms breeze travel crib review - the 4moms mattress is somewhat disappointing compared to the...

The Breeze offers average features for comfort. The Breeze has a standard one-inch mattress. It is polyurethane foam it is on the firm side and stiff compared to the competition. However, it doesn't compress as easily as some others, and it was more comfortable as a result. It is one of the easiest to get baby in and out of without discomfort to caregivers.

4moms breeze travel crib review - even at a quick glance, you can see the quality in the design and...

The Breeze is a top-quality choice with a price to match. The 4moms shines in the quality department with durable material and a sturdy frame. The mesh is very tight but scratchy, and the frame doesn't shake or move no matter where you push unlike most of the competition we tested. We didn't experience any issues related to quality, but at least one Amazon reviewer remarked that the bassinet began to sag after a few months of use.

The Breeze doesn't appear to give much consideration to eco-health. 4moms doesn't make any claims offering information on what their materials include, besides meeting both the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) and the Consumer Product Safety Improvement Act (CPSIA) requirements. However, this has nothing to do with flame retardants which are not legally required and have been proven harmful to the baby's health. The Center For Environmental Health (CEH) maintains a list of major brand manufacturers and their use of flame retardants . 4moms is not on this list.

4moms Pack and Play Review: Breeze, Breeze Go and Breeze Plus Review

The 4Moms playard lineup consists of the breeze® Plus and breeze® Go , plus a few previous versions of their beloved Breeze lineup that have been discontinued (but you may still find for sale on used marketplaces).

I already owned one of the old 4Moms Breeze Pack and Plays (which was simply known as the Breeze), but wanted to test out the new models as well to compare the Breeze Plus and Breeze Go against my old school Breeze, figure out the difference between the Breeze Go vs Breeze Plus, and decide which of the two current models is best for every type of family.

Below, you’ll find my 4Moms Breeze review, which is actually 2 reviews in one post. I cover the Breeze Plus and the Breeze Go , and compare each of the 4moms play pens so you can decide which Breeze is best for your life – and whether the Breeze family is even the right pack and play for you. You’ll also see appearances from my old Breeze (the one with the blue mattresses).

Personal Experience and Testing for this 4Moms Breeze Review

In terms of my own personal experience owning and testing these pack and plays, I own a 4Moms Breeze (an old model that is discontinued). I also bought the new Breeze Plus for the purpose of this review.

I bought both myself, and this post isn’t sponsored by 4Moms. I didn’t buy one of the new 4Moms Breeze Go pack and plays, since the frame is exactly the same as the Breeze Plus, without the bassinet and flip changer (if you’re confused about this, I explain it all in the post below!).

All of the photos you see in this post are of my own 4Moms Breeze playards, and the insights and thoughts I’ve added to this review are from my experience using and testing the products myself.

4moms Breeze Playard, Breeze Plus and Breeze Go Reviews

Who is 4moms.

4moms was established in 2006 by Rob Daley and Henry Thorn – not, as the name suggested to me, by 4 moms (I think it references being “for moms” not started by “four moms”).

It’s a very well established and well regarded brand, particularly well known for making high end versions of essential baby gear, including play yards, the mamaRoo® baby swing, and high chairs .

What is the 4Moms Breeze Playard?

4Moms has two pack and plays, both of which fall under the Breeze brand. The 4moms Breeze lineup currently consists of the Breeze Plus and the Breeze Go .

They are notable (and loved by parents) for being some of the easiest to use pack and plays I’ve tested. You can setup the frame with one hand in mere seconds, and collapsing when you’re done is just as easy. One push in a single motion and the frame is set up. This is a defining feature and one of the reasons parents rave about them!

I even made a 6-second GIF of me opening my 4moms playpen.

Both the Breeze Plus and Breeze Go are high quality, sturdy, easy to use, well-made and safe play yards. They’re also somewhat portable, although I will say neither Breeze can compete on portability with the best lightweight travel cribs such as the BabyBjorn Travel Crib Light or the Guava Lotus Everywhere Crib (and even, to a lesser extend, the Bugaboo Stardust ).

4Moms Breeze Go vs Plus

At the time of writing, 4moms offers both the Breeze Go and Breeze Plus in their lineup of Breeze play yards.

The main frame of the Breeze Go and Breeze Plus are the same, although the fabric and frame color is different, depending on which you buy. The Breeze Go comes in grey and the Breeze Plus is black.

The difference between the two models is in the accessories that come with them.

The Breeze Plus, as the name suggests, offers more bells and whistles than the Breeze Go, including a newborn bassinet, detachable flip changer (changing table), and a convertible mattress that works on the play pen floor or in the bassinet. It offers nice-to-have accessories when you have an infant, and then as baby grows, you can store those away and use it as a play pen or safe space for baby when you’re trying to get something done.

The Breeze Go offers the same durable playard, without the baby care station extras (no bassinet, no flip down changer for quick diapering and clothing changes).

Both models also come with a similar carry bag for easy transport.

For the added convenience, the Breeze Plus is more expensive than the Breeze Go.

The exact price difference varies based on the retailer and whether there are any promotions on, but it’s typically not a massive difference in price. If you have an infant, it’s likely worth getting the Plus version. If your baby is already over the bassinet weight limit of 18 lbs, or they can push up on their hands and knees, then the Go version is likely a better bet, as they will have already outgrown the infant pack and play features (unless you plan on having more kids in the future).

4Moms Breeze Go and Breeze Plus At a Glance

  • Easy to open and close/collapse with only one hand needed to push open and take the down frame
  • Comes with a carry bag
  • Newborn attachment (bassinet) included in the Breeze Plus
  • Can use both the Breeze Go and Breeze Plus from birth with newborns and as baby grows
  • Included flip changer for quick diapering and clothing changes (Plus only)
  • Bassinet and changer are easy to attach and detach
  • Excellent quality materials and construction from a known and trusted brand
  • Fire retardant free
  • Mesh sides for adequate airflow and visibility
  • Modern and sleek looking, with neutral colors that will look good in any space
  • Lighter than most pack and plays (although not as light as a travel crib)
  • Super easy way to provide a safe space for your baby when you need to put them down for a bit
  • Included travel bag is made of thin material that rips easily.
  • The mattress lacks a removable cover
  • Have to use 4Moms branded sheets in order for the mattress attachment system to work
  • More expensive than many other popular pack and plays
  • 4Moms doesn't offer some accessories I'd want, most notably a mosquito net for some climates
  • Not machine washable.

4Moms Breeze Review

Setup and collapsing the 4moms breeze pack and play: ease of use tests.

The 4Moms Breeze pack and play markets itself as having one handed setup and one handed pull close system.

I was skeptical of this, but what I found is it does offer one handed setup…but only sort of.

One Handed Set Up Test

To put it to the test, I tried to set it up myself one handed. I forced myself to use only one hand by holding a Squishmallow with my other hand, as if I were holding a baby and trying to set it up and collapse it.

I have to admit: the center pillar system makes it insanely easy to get the pack and play frame open and setup up one handed with a one push open that requires a single motion to get the frame ready.

With my old Breeze, I wasn’t able to set it up as seamlessly as in 4Moms’ marketing videos. When I try it, I find the playard feet get a bit stuck on my area rug.

This has been improved in the new versions, as the one push open works flawlessly in my new Plus.

Attaching the Mattress

While I was able to set up the pack and play frame easily enough, I can’t get it completely setup one handed.

The problem? I need two hands to attach the mattress to the frame using the velcro tabs (a necessary step before putting your baby in it).

With my old Breeze, this was a massive challenge, and I really disliked the system.

Somehow, it works awesome with my new Breeze Plus, and is super easy to attach – you just need two hands to do it (one hand to feed it through the hole, and the other hand to attach it).

How Fast Can You Setup a 4Moms Breeze?

To truly test out how quickly it opens, I timed myself opening it, first with one handed setup and then with two hands.

These tests were done with my old Breeze. My new Breeze Plus is even faster.

One handed, it took me 20 seconds to setup the frame and put the mattress into the porta crib base. I was unable to attach the mattress to the frame using the velcro tab system with just one hand, so I timed myself setting it up again, this time with two hands allowed.

Using two hands, it took me 3 minutes and 4 seconds to get the old 4Moms Breeze setup properly.

The bulk of that time was getting the velcro tabs pulled through the slots and attached to the underside of the crib base. Again, 4moms has made the new Breeze much easier in this regard, and setup time is even faster for me.

How Fast Can You Collapse a 4Moms Breeze?

I also tested how long it took me to collapse the crib using the pull close system, again setting a timer and holding a Squishmallow. I did this test one handed, and I was able to get the mattress unattached (via the velcro tabs) fairly easily with just one hand.

This test took me 30 seconds total: 26 seconds to get the mattress detached and out of the pack and play base, plus another 4 seconds to use the pull close to collapse the frame.

Super fast!

Setting up the Bassinet

The newborn bassinet insert is just as easy to setup.

The bassinet has a fabric border that drapes over the main frame like a fitted sheet.

It has built-in clips that then clip into place on every side of the main play yard frame (the updated clip system in the current model is pictured below – I like these clips a lot better than the old ones).

I did a timed test, and it took me 36 seconds to attach the bassinet to the frame. I found it easiest to clip it in place as I went. Otherwise I found the fabric just keeps slipping off the frame and falling down into the main base of the play yard.

The bassinet mattress velcros in place easily, with no tabs to fiddle with.

Removing the bassinet is just as easy: it took me 28 seconds to get the removable bassinet off the frame (bassinet mattress and bassinet attachment).

Portability When Traveling with It

While the name of the 4Moms Breeze Go might make you think it’s up for a big vacation, I’d caution against using it as a true travel crib.

Trips to Grandma’s house or a several hour road trip to stay at your BFF’s house? Great!

Multi-week trip through 5 countries in Europe? Not with this play yard.

It’s portable, yes, and is pretty good in terms of portability when compared to other playards.

However, it’s not a true travel crib, primarily due to its bulk and weight. The Breeze Go is 23 pounds, a whopping 10 pounds heavier than the BabyBjorn Travel Crib , for example.

As far as playards go, 23 pounds is very light! It’s just not “travel crib” light, and I can’t imagine hauling this on a train from Rome to Florence, if you know what I mean.

The BreezeGo and Plus also come with a convenient travel bag included, but I’d suggest it’s more designed as a storage bag than a travel bag.

If you check it in, or do too much travel with it, the carry bag will likely get some rips and tears in it. Our old 4Moms portable crib went on one trip to Los Angeles, and the carry bag did indeed take a fair amount of abuse during the trip.

The fabric is very thin when I feel it. It feels especially thin when I do a direct comparison with the BabyBjorn or Guava Lotus travel bags, which are more like a strong, durable backpack material.

Bag wise, the bassinet attachment and changer on the Breeze Plus also don’t fit into the carry bag, making them extras you need to find somewhere to fit when packing for a trip.

All of those factors combined mean I don’t recommend this pack and play for travel. It’s great for short jaunts, but for a true travel experience, you’ll want something more purpose built for trips!

4Moms Play Yard Mattress Review

The mattress in both of our 4Moms pack and plays is pretty standard, albeit a bit lack luster.

The old Breeze playard (the one pictured below) had a separate mattress for the playard and the bassinet. It was just under 1″ thick when I measured ours, and when I compared that by measuring our new Breeze Plus playard mattress, it was more or less the same thickness (just under 1″ thick).

In the updated Breeze Plus , there’s now only one mattress that converts for use with either the playard or the bassinet.

This is an improvement, because who wants to tote around two pack and play mattresses when they don’t have to? Not me.

The bassinet part of the 4moms mattress has also be upgraded quality wise in the latest model of the Breeze Plus. My old bassinet mattress is incredibly thin – thinner than the ~1″ I measured for the main mattress thickness. In the new Breeze Plus, the mattress is the same quality for both the bassinet and the play pen.

Generally, pack and play mattresses are pretty thin, which is done on purpose for safety reasons.

However, out of the pack and plays I’ve reviewed, I’d say the 4Moms mattress isn’t particularly impressive – it’s much thinner than the BabyBjorn Travel Crib mattress for example, which is often commented on as one of the best playard mattresses!

Worth noting, that since the Breeze doesn’t have a floor-sitting mattress (like the BabyBjorn does), it’s likely fine that it’s thinner and not quite as plush. Firmer mattresses are generally better for infants . It’s when you get into the slightly older babies (over one year) and toddlers that I think the “is this pack and play mattress comfortable enough?” worries have merit.

You also pretty much need to use 4Moms branded pack and play sheets if you intend to use a sheet with it. Otherwise the velcro attachment system won’t work. (Pack and play sheets are different from crib sheets – don’t use crib sheets on your play yard as they’ll be too big, and extra fabric could be hazardous)

If you don’t use sheets? Expect stains on the mattress, which can only be spot cleaned.

The bassinet also requires specific 4moms sheets for the velcro to work. They have holes in the back to let the velcro patches attach properly.

4Moms Playard Design and Color Choices

In my experience, pack and plays tend to fall into one of two categories from a design perspective: modern and adult-looking, or babyish with kid designs and colors.

The Breeze Plus and Go definitely fall into the former, which is a plus in my books.

The Plus comes in black, and the Go comes in a dark grey color. Both have white mattresses in the current version. 4Moms appears to have done away with the bright blue mattress option, which is another plus in my books. The sheets are also quite neutral looking.

The frame on both models is covered in fabric, which is nice for a baby comfort and safety perspective. The sides are mesh, allowing airflow and visibility for baby and caregivers.

4Moms Breeze Safety Review

The Breeze meets relevant federal safety standards, a requirement to be able to sell it in the US and Canada.

Beyond that, when I look at our own Breeze pack and plays, I am interested in its sturdiness (especially for older babies and toddlers who may stand , jump and attempt to climb out ), any gaps that could allow a baby to get a body part stuck, and invisible dangers, such as harmful chemicals.

Our 4Moms Breeze is incredibly stable and sturdy. When I push on it and try to rattle it around, it shifts slightly from side to side, but stands firm overall. It’s certainly sturdier than the lightweight travel cribs I’ve personally tested, including the Phil & Teds Traveller , Guava Lotus Everywhere Crib , and BabyBjorn Travel Crib Light .

I also don’t notice anything that worries me from a “getting stuck” perspective.

Finally I love that the 4Moms Breeze is free from fire retardant chemicals , phthalates and PVC, BPA and BPS, Lead, and heavy metals. While the “filling” (which I take to mean mattress) contains polyurethane, I appreciate that 4Moms has gone quite far in ensuring the product is non toxic.

Washing the 4Moms Breeze

Overall, I find the washability of the 4Moms Breeze to be lacking, and an area for improvement.

For one, the fabric on the Breeze isn’t removable, so you can’t do a full machine wash as you can with the BabyBjorn Travel Crib Light or the Guava Lotus Everywhere Crib , for example. This isn’t particularly surprising as most true pack and plays (as opposed to lightweight travel cribs) don’t have removable fabric. But, it’s also an incredibly convenient feature when I do have it, and it is lacking on this playard.

Easier to fix would be a removable mattress cover, which the Breeze also doesn’t have. 4Moms sells waterproof sheets separately, but I expect a good number of families will opt to use it without the sheets, which means you’ll end up with stains on the mattress like this.

So how do you wash the 4Moms Breeze? Proper pack and play cleaning involves spot cleaning the mattress and using a damp cloth to wipe down the fabric and frame as needed. It’s not perfect, but it works. I’ve given my old Breeze a good spot clean scrub and it has come clean fairly easily.

Using the 4Moms Breeze as a Short Parent

I sometimes struggle with pack and plays and cribs because of my height: I’m 5 foot tall.

The top of the top rail on my 4Moms Breeze measures 28.5″ high (4moms says 29″ which would also incorporate the slightly raised corner joints). When I lean over it to touch the mattress, the top bar hits me right below the bottom of my rib cage, which is the same for most pack and plays I’ve tested.

However, since the mattress isn’t a floor sitting mattress with this playard (the mattress sits on a supported base off the floor), I find it’s comfortable reaching all the way down to the mattress, even as a short mom. The distance between the mattress and the top of the top bar is just under 23″ – so the actual distance you’re reaching down is quite manageable, even for short caregivers, based on my experience.

New vs. Old: What’s New on the Breeze Plus Playard?

The most recent model of the Breeze Plus includes detachable flip changer, bassinet, and a convertible mattress.

On the new model, the bassinet and changing table are separate attachments. The bassinet spans the length and width of the play yard (bigger than the version right before this iteration), and then the changer can clip on top of the bassinet and flip out of the way when not in use.

Previous version of the Plus had one attachment instead of two, divided into the changing part and the bassinet part.

Flip Changer

The new flip changer is a great addition, because you can flip it out of the way on the side of the pack and play when not in use.

Watch me use the convenient flip changer in this GIF I made.

Previous models of the Breeze Plus has two separate mattresses: one for the playard and one for the bassinet. Kind of a pain if you need to travel with it.

The new version has a convertible mattress that goes from the larger mattress for the playard to the smaller mattress for the bassinet by unzipping two panels.

As noted before, it’s also easier to attach via the velcro tab system.

Should You Buy a 4Moms Breeze Pack and Play? Who’s It For

  • An awesome pack and play in your own home that will last from bringing your new baby home from the hospital to around 2.5 or 3 years old.
  • For a newborn to sleep in his or her parents room as a first bed, using the newborn baby bassinet attachment. You can also let a newborn sleep in the Breeze Go playard, you’ll just have to lean down further to pick up and put down.
  • Driving holidays or trips to visit family, when you want to bring a pack and play with you rather than rely on the hotel for a crib rental.

Not Good For

  • A travel crib when traveling by plane, train, or bus. While it’d be fine for a road trip to one destination, it’s too heavy to be lugging around compared to a a travel crib when traveling by plane or to multiple destinations. Add to that, the included travel bag is a bit thin for checked luggage – ours got ripped up when checked, and the updated bag isn’t any more durable in my opinion.
  • Families on a strict budget. You can get far cheaper options from some major, well respected brands if you’re on a tight budget.

Which 4Moms Portable Crib Should You Buy: Breeze Plus vs. Breeze Go

Whether you buy the Breeze Go or Breeze Plus Playard depends on whether you want the bassinet and flip away changer. In addition to budget, for many families I expect it will come down to how old your child is at the time of purchase, and whether you plan on having more kids in the future that could use the newborn features (the bassinet is good up to 18 pounds, or when your little can push themselves up).

Finally, if you plan to use it with a newborn and would prefer to buy the less expensive Breeze Go, it’s worth considering your birth plan, and whether you’re likely to end up with a C-section vs vaginal birth.

I had a C-section, and the thought of leaning all the way over to the bottom of a pack and play to put down and pick up my baby after that major of a surgery is not a happy thought!

Dimensions and Age / Weight Limits

  • The Breeze Frame measures 43″L x 30″W x 29″H.
  • Weight of the Breeze Go and Breeze Plus without the bassinet and changer is 23 lbs.
  • Weight of the Breeze Plus with the bassinet and changer is 28.5 lbs.

Age Limit and Weight Limits

Pack and play weight limits and age limits vary by brand and model. Here’s what 4moms has to say about their Breeze playards.

  • The bassinet can be used from birth until your baby reaches 18 pounds or can push themselves up, whichever comes first.
  • The changer attachment is suitable from birth until 25 pounds (again, discontinue use once your baby can push themselves up).
  • The play pen weight limit is 30 pounds

  • Elektrostal, known as the “Motor City of Russia,” is a vibrant and growing city with a rich industrial history, offering diverse cultural experiences and a strong commitment to environmental sustainability.
  • With its convenient location near Moscow, Elektrostal provides a picturesque landscape, vibrant nightlife, and a range of recreational activities, making it an ideal destination for residents and visitors alike.

Known as the “Motor City of Russia.”

Elektrostal, a city located in the Moscow Oblast region of Russia, earned the nickname “Motor City” due to its significant involvement in the automotive industry.

Home to the Elektrostal Metallurgical Plant.

Elektrostal is renowned for its metallurgical plant, which has been producing high-quality steel and alloys since its establishment in 1916.

Boasts a rich industrial heritage.

Elektrostal has a long history of industrial development, contributing to the growth and progress of the region.

Founded in 1916.

The city of Elektrostal was founded in 1916 as a result of the construction of the Elektrostal Metallurgical Plant.
